Ebook Description

Building Enterprise AI Agents: From Prototype to Production-Grade LLM Systems is a comprehensive technical and architectural guide for designing, deploying, and governing large language model (LLM)–powered AI agents in real-world enterprise environments.


As generative AI rapidly reshapes how organizations interact with data, automate workflows, and deliver intelligent applications, many teams struggle to move beyond prototypes toward reliable, secure, and scalable production systems. This ebook addresses that gap by providing an end-to-end blueprint for building enterprise-grade AI agents that are grounded in enterprise data, integrated with operational systems, and governed by design.


Starting with foundational concepts in artificial intelligence, generative AI, prompt engineering, and agent theory, the book explains how LLMs reason, where they excel, and where they introduce risks such as hallucinations, cost unpredictability, and integration complexity. It then introduces the core architectural patterns that underpin modern agentic systems, including tool-augmented reasoning, retrieval-augmented generation (RAG), and goal-driven orchestration.


A central focus of the guide is the unified AI development and operations model enabled by the Databricks Data Intelligence Platform. The ebook explores how components such as Mosaic AI, Model Serving, Vector Search, AI SQL Functions, Agent Bricks, and AI/BI work together to support scalable agent orchestration, secure tool access, and enterprise-grade governance through Unity Catalog. Special emphasis is placed on cost management, observability, scalability trade-offs, and operational reliability when running AI systems at scale.


The final chapters examine the rapidly evolving ecosystem of AI agent frameworks and interoperability standards, including LangChain, multi-agent architectures, and the Model Context Protocol (MCP). The book also highlights how MLflow’s ResponsesAgent interface provides a unifying, OpenAI-compatible abstraction that standardizes deployment, evaluation, monitoring, and governance across diverse models and agent frameworks.


Together, these chapters provide a practical, architecture-first roadmap for organizations and practitioners seeking to transition from experimental AI pilots to robust, production-grade AI agents that operate reliably within complex enterprise data environments.
